What is the Maternal Fetal Medicine Referral Request Form?
The Maternal Fetal Medicine Referral Request Form is a critical tool in the healthcare system, especially for expectant mothers. This form facilitates access to specialized maternal fetal medicine services, which are essential for addressing the complexities associated with high-risk pregnancies. The primary use of this referral form is to schedule consultations, request specific tests, and ensure that vital medical information is efficiently communicated.
This form is typically utilized for various examinations that can be requested, such as ultrasonography and amniocentesis, supporting expectant mothers in their journey toward a healthy pregnancy.

Information You'll Need to Gather Before Completing the Form
Before submitting the Maternal Fetal Medicine Referral Request Form, it is essential to gather relevant documents and information. Be prepared to provide:
-
Insurance details such as policy numbers and provider information.
-
Past medical history related to the pregnancy.
-
Specific information such as Social Security Number (SSN) and referring physician's contact details.
Having accurate and comprehensive information will greatly enhance the efficiency of the referral process.

Who is eligible to use the Maternal Fetal Medicine Referral Request Form?
The form can be used by any expectant mother or healthcare provider wishing to request specialized maternal fetal services. Patients should consult their physician to determine the necessity of the referral.
Are there any deadlines for submitting this form?
While there are no strict deadlines, it is advisable to submit the Maternal Fetal Medicine Referral Request Form as soon as possible to ensure timely scheduling of appointments, especially during pregnancy.
What submission methods are available for this form?
The form can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ller, or it may also be printed and sent via fax or mail to the designated healthcare facility or physician.
What supporting documents are required with the referral form?
Typically, a copy of the patient's insurance card and any relevant medical history or previous test results may be required alongside the form for comprehensive evaluation by the maternal fetal specialist.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out this form?
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ately. Common mistakes include omitting patient information, misspelling names, or failing to sign the form where required.
How long does it take to process the referral after submission?
Processing times can vary; however, expect a response within a few days to a week. Contact the referring physician’s office for specific inquiries regarding your referral status.
Can someone other than the patient fill out the form?
Yes, a referring physician or authorized healthcare staff can complete the Maternal Fetal Medicine Referral Request Form on behalf of the patient. Ensure all necessary patient consent is obtained.
